Yasin Malik remanded till Oct 27: JKLF

Pays tribute to slain Nowgam militants

Srinagar, Oct 24 : Jammu and Kashmir Liberation Front (JKLF) while condemning prolonging incarceration of its chairman, Muhammad Yasin Malik and termed it as ‘most undemocratic and unethical’.
A spokesman said that Malik along with JKLF Zonal Organizer Bashir Ahmad Kashmiri, Ghulam Muhammad Dar and Javed Ahmad Mir have been remanded up to 27th October.
In a statement issued to KPS, JKLF also paid tributes to slain Doctor Sabzar Ahmad and Asif Ahmad Gojri who were killed in an encounter today at Nowgam.
